What they do
A Crossing Patrol Guard is a vehicle traffic manager normally stationed on busy roadways to aid pedestrians or manage the movement of vehicles. They are often employed to assist around schools, events, or construction work.

School van aide Reginas Transportation services llc Waterbury, CT Job Details Part-time | Full-time From $18 an hour 8 hours ago Qualifications School experience CPR Certification Confidential information handling Behavioral standards enforcement in schools Experience working with individuals with disabilities Transporting special needs passengers Passenger loading and unloading procedures Safety regulations Parent collaboration Conflict de-escalation Physical assistance for special education students Classroom behavior modification First Aid Certification Collaboration with other professionals for student support Child safety supervision Working with students Student support Child emergency evacuation Parent communication in school administration Experience working with individuals with physical disabilities School policy and procedure enforcement Communication skills Passenger safety regulations Passenger safety Entry level First aid and CPR Full Job Description Overview Join our dedicated team as a School Van Aide and play a vital role in ensuring the safe and smooth transportation of students with diverse needs. This energetic position offers an opportunity to support children during their daily commutes, promote safety, and foster a positive environment for students with disabilities or special education needs. As a School Van Aide, you will work closely with drivers, teachers, and parents to uphold school policies and provide compassionate assistance to students, making a meaningful difference in their educational journey. Responsibilities Assist the school bus driver in supervising students during transportation, ensuring their safety and well-being throughout the trip Support students with physical disabilities or special needs by helping them board, disembark, and secure themselves safely on the bus Enforce school policies and transportation safety regulations to maintain a secure environment for all students Implement behavior management techniques to promote positive conduct and address conflicts or disruptions calmly and effectively Communicate regularly with parents and school staff regarding student behavior, needs, or concerns during transit Support emergency procedures including evacuation drills and first aid response when necessary Maintain confidentiality of student information and adhere strictly to privacy policies Experience Prior experience working with children, especially those with disabilities or in special education settings Knowledge of behavior management strategies tailored for students with special needs Certification in First Aid and CPR is highly desirable; training will be provided if needed Familiarity with school policies, safety regulations, and transportation procedures Strong communication skills to collaborate effectively with staff, parents, and students Ability to handle conflict situations with patience, professionalism, and conflict management skills Physical ability to assist students during boarding/disembarking and support mobility as required This role is an essential part of our commitment to providing safe, supportive transportation for all students.
